I notice that the thin washers surrounding the felt seals protecting the main wheel bearings are not flat. The Cleveland instructions with the install kit are silent about which way to orient them during assembly. Are they supposed to pooch inwards towards the wheel center, or outwards, or one each way to embrace the the seal felt? One each way doesn't make much sense, but it is physically possible, and both in or both out fit equally well.

Are you talking about the washers which have a lip to them? Almost like a T? If those are the ones then you want the flat part ( the top of the T) facing out of the wheel. The felt seal will nest inside the washer. At least that is the way we did it when I used to assemble wheels at Grove Aircraft (and they are essentially copies of Clevelands).
